Binance Will Support the Rootstock Infrastructure Framework (RIF) Network Upgrade and Hard Fork
According to the official announcement, Binance will support the RIF Network upgrade and hard fork. Deposits and withdrawals of tokens on the Rootstock Infrastructure Framework (RIF) network will be suspended starting at 17:00 on May 4, 2026. The network upgrade and hard fork will occur at block height 8,804,200, approximately at 18:00 on May 4, 2026. Once the upgraded network stabilizes, deposits and withdrawals of tokens on this network will resume.
